Abstract:
The liquid–liquid extraction of cobalt(II) from sulfate medium with N-(2- hydroxybenzylidene)aniline is studied with the following parameters: pH, concentration of the extractant and the nature of diluent. The solvent extraction of cobalt(II) in different diluents leads to third phase formation. The stoichiometry coefficients of the extracted complexes are determined by the slope analysis method. The extaction constants are evaluated for the different diluents. The extraction is better in the following order: cyclohexane > toluene > chloroform.

Abstract:
Operating in a cell of water/CHCl3/water, it is shown that there is a preferential transport of Ca2+/Mg2+ by A.23187. On the basis of measurements of flux of extraction and of flux of liberation in a half-cell of water/CHCl3, it is shown that the selectivity of the transport is related to the kinetics of liberation, which is markedly different for the two ions and which could be explained by the structure of the complex dimers that are formed, according to the corresponding crystallographic studies.
